分页: 1 / 2

|共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-17 0:56
qq274980
在Linux下打字飞快的朋友,遇到中文目录和文件名立马就慢下来了,

有2种选择:
1、切换成中文输入一两个字然后按TAB补全
2、动用鼠标

现在有第三种选择了, :em11

用拼音补全命令行中的中文名称和路径

实验目录如下:
biff@lenovo:/domain/WorkSpace$ ls
SVN培训 全球眼 浙江建行 浙江农信

使用: (输完后按 TAB 键自动补全)
cd S <tab> 进入[SVN培训]
cd q <tab> 进入[全球眼]
cd z <tab> 自动补全[浙江]
cd zj <tab><tab> 提示[浙江建行 浙江农信]备选
cd 浙江j <tab> 进入[浙江建行]
cd zjj <tab> 进入[浙江建行]
cd zj1 <tab> 进入[浙江建行]
cd zj2 <tab> 进入[浙江农信]

这第3种方法是前两种方法不能比的,自已用了半个月了,超爽!

共享给大家,有意见再改。 (够用就好,小BUG还是有的)

下载软件包,解压,参考 install.sh 进行安装。
https://groups.google.com/group/binsos/ ... 7a2cf4bfab
chsdir20090509.tar.gz
chsdir20090509.tar.gz
(3.06 KiB) 已下载 126 次

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-17 1:07
nuanhuai
怎么没人回复

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-17 1:14
AutoXBC
没需要,下了纯备用,楼主强人。

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-21 20:15
lonelycorn
好NB!
不过现在我根本就没有中文目录了。

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-21 20:43
wyfhyl
呵呵,楼主太强了,这都可以找到。谢谢分享了

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-21 23:32
qq274980
BUG修订,升级在
https://groups.google.com/group/binsos/ ... 7a2cf4bfab

用的虽少,偶尔用用也很爽,特别是打开文件
对我自已这样很少用nautilus的人来说还是很有用的 :em01

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-21 23:36
xiooli
我直接是ctrl+p文件轮换了。

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-21 23:38
qq274980
扼,在bash里面我只用 set -o vi 模式,

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-05-22 8:49
eexpress
思路不错哦。估计习惯了就好。等小白去稳定

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-01 9:53
qq274980
功能升级:
1、加入多音字支持,比如:音乐,可以用 cd yy 或者 cd yl
2、模糊拼音支持,比如:通讯录.txt,可以用 vim txn 或者 vim txl (敲tab自动补全)

https://groups.google.com/group/binsos/ ... 7a2cf4bfab

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-01 10:18
daf3707
有点意思 :em11

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-01 10:42
543082593
思路很好
但是 我想很多人现在都很少中文目录了吧
实在是懒得切换输入法

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-01 10:44
qq274980
软件、音乐都用SOFT/MUSIC了,但是工作目录还是逃不掉的,比如项目文档

:em02

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-03 20:32
lonelycorn
我的目录是干净的一水ASCII字符。当然vfat分区不保证。

Re: |共享| 用拼音补全命令行中的中文名称和路径

发表于 : 2009-09-03 22:47
yunpengwu
这个脚本实现的功能是我一直想要的,可惜自己水平不济。lz的脚本太及时啦!